This Day in History:

1460 University of Basel founded in Swiss Confederacy (now Switzerland)

1581 Francis Drake, world explorer, knighted by Queen Elizabeth I aboard his galleon "Golden Hind" at Deptford, England

1655 The miraculous statue entitled the Infant of Prague is solemnly crowned by command of Cardinal Harrach

1687 English King James II publishes his Declaration of Indulgence, a step towards establishing freedom of religion in the British Isles

1789 First US Congress begins regular sessions during George Washington's presidency at Federal Hall, NYC (ends 1791)

1814 An officer mutiny forces French Emperor Napoléon Bonaparte to abdicate for the first time in flavor of his son, who is not accepted by the Allies occupying Paris

1818 Congress decides on the US flag: 13 red & white stripes & 20 stars

1828 Casparus van Wooden patents chocolate milk powder in Amsterdam

1841 Vice President John Tyler becomes the 10th President of the United States after the death of President William Henry Harrison

1850 City of Los Angeles incorporated

1866 Ashmun Institute, in Oxford, Pennsylvania, is renamed Lincoln University

1870 Golden Gate Park forms by City Order #800

1887 Susanna Madora Salter elected 1st US woman mayor in Argonia, Kansas

1896 Announcement of the discovery of gold in the Yukon

1902 Cecil Rhodes scholarship fund forms with $10 million

1905 Earthquake in Kangra India, kills 20,000

1912 Chinese republic proclaimed in Tibet

1917 US Senate agrees (82-6) to participate in WWI

1932 Charles G. King, University of Pittsburgh isolates Vitamin C, using adrenal samples provided by Hungarian Albert Szent-Györgyi

1933 USS Akron dirigible crashes into Atlantic Ocean, off coast of New Jersey, in stormy weather; 73 die including US Navy Rear Admiral William A. Moffett - a major proponent of the airship fleet, there were 3 survivors

1943 WWII: US Army Air Force bomber 'Lady Be Good' fails to return to Soluch, Libya base after its maiden flight; presumed lost at sea, wreck was discovered in desert 15 years later

1947 Convention on International Civil Aviation goes into effect

1947 Largest group of sunspots on record

1947 UN's International Civil Aviation Organization forms

1949 North Atlantic Treaty Organization (NATO) treaty signed in Washington, D.C.

1960 SETI Project Ozma begins at the Green Bank, WV, radio astronomy center

1968 Apollo 6 launched atop Saturn V; unmanned

1968 US civil rights activist Martin Luther King Jr. is assassinated by James Earl Ray at the Lorraine Hotel in Memphis, Tennessee

1968 Riots break out in over 100 cities in the United States following the assassination of African-American civil rights activist Martin Luther King Jr.

1969 Haskell Karp receives the 1st temporary artificial heart, implanted by surgeon Denton Cooley at Texas Heart Institute in Houston

1972 1st electric power plant fueled by garbage begins operating

1973 World Trade Center, then the world's tallest building, opens in New York (110 stories). Later destroyed in 9/11 terrorist attacks.

1975 Microsoft is founded as a partnership between Bill Gates and Paul Allen to develop and sell BASIC interpreters for the Altair 8800

1981 Henry Cisneros becomes 1st Mexican-American mayor (San Antonio)

1983 6th NASA Space Shuttle Mission: Challenger 1 launches

1991 Senator John Heinz of Pennsylvania and six others are killed when a helicopter collides with their plane over an elementary school in Merion, Pennsylvania.

1994 Netscape Communications founded as Mosaic Communications

1997 STS 83 (Columbia 22), launches

1999 Jack Ma founds Chinese internet company Alibaba

2010 Africa's tallest monument, the African Renaissance Monument, dedicated outside Dakar, Senegal, designed by Pierre Goudiaby to commemorate Senegal's 50th anniversary of independence

2013 Poecilotheria rajaei, a giant tarantula with a 20cm leg span, is discovered in Sri Lanka

2014 President of the World Bank, Jim Yong Kim, claims that climate change will lead to battles over water and food within the next five to ten years

2017 Alibaba becomes the world's largest retailer according to US Securities and Exchange Commission

2017 Pink Star diamond sets world record price of $71 million for a gem at an action in Hong Kong

2022 Eon Musk buys 9.2% of Twitter stock, making him the company's largest shareholder

2023 Finland officially joins NATO at a ceremony in Brussels, becoming its 31st member and doubling NATO's border with Russia
